Ex-Champ Names Best Opponent for Richard Torrez

Former world champion Timothy Bradley believes the perfect next opponent for rising American heavyweight Richard Torrez is none other than his fellow countryman, Jared Anderson.

You know who I want to see him fight? I want to see him against Jared Anderson. Seriously. Anderson should be next for Torrez.

Vianello was a solid test—Torrez passed it. Got the job done.

Let’s rewind—they’ve got history. Torrez beat him in the amateurs, right? Now Torrez is rising fast, just passed his first real test. He beat a guy who beat Arslanbek Makhmudov and has faced legit opponents. So why not make the fight?

Why not let them fight and find out who’s better? Who’s the best in Top Rank’s heavyweight stable, huh?” Bradley said.

In his most recent outing, Richard Torrez scored a unanimous decision win over Guido Vianello. Jared Anderson, meanwhile, earned a dominant points victory over Mario Collias. A clash between the two young American talents could answer some big questions in the heavyweight division.
